<p>The Fairfield Greenwich Group has agreed to pay an $8 million settlement to <a href="http://www.usatoday.com/money/industries/brokerage/2009-09-08-madoff-feeder-fund_N.htm" target="_blank">a small group of investors in Massachusetts</a> that lost money through the Madoff scam. This is expected to be a full repayment. Fairfield is also going to pay a $500,000 fine to the Commonwealth of Massachusetts. As part of the deal, the feeder fund does not have to admit any wrongdoing. </p>
<p>According to a report in <em><a href="http://www.usatoday.com/money/industries/brokerage/2009-09-08-madoff-feeder-fund_N.htm" target="_blank">USA Today</a></em>, this is the first Madoff case in which a regulator secured some relief for investors.
